
Mary Cassatt: Impressionist From Philadelphia · 1977
Mary Cassatt: Impressionist From Philadelphia (1977) is a Documentary film directed by Perry Miller Adato, starring Leora Dana, Guy Sorel, Mary Jane Higby.

Mary Cassatt: Impressionist From Philadelphia (1977) is a Documentary film directed by Perry Miller Adato, starring Leora Dana, Guy Sorel, Mary Jane Higby.
This documentary portrait is the first to celebrate the only American member of the French Impressionist school and the first American woman to become a famous painter. 'Mary Cassatt Impressionist From Philadelphia' is not only a biography of the artist’s life and work; the film sees both in the context of the status of the woman painter in Victorian America in the second half of the 19th century.
